Quality Assurance Specialist
Life Science Logistics LLC
Job Description
Job Description
Responsibilities
- Provide support during regulatory FDA, DEA, State inspections and customer audits.
- Plan and present Quality System information to internal and external groups.
- Initiate, review, and approve Change Controls, Recalls, Deviation for nonconformances, & Reactive Maintenance.
- Work to maintain Quality Systems policies and procedures to ensure regulatory compliance
- Be a part of the internal audit team and assist in external audits.
- Release “quarantined” product upon receipt of documentation from Client and use Hold and Release process, take part in Recall.
- Review/approve product-specific paperwork particular to Client guidelines, Deviations and CAPAs.
- Assist in Operations and Facilities team in determining root cause of discrepancies and help develop corrective actions and verification activities.
- Revise SOPs and WIs for process enhancement.
- Perform Gemba walk applies six sigma concepts such as 5S’s.
- Participate in cross-functional initiatives for a 3PL environment.
- Strong leadership skills and logistics (3PL) knowledge.
- Able to professionally communicate with customers/clients.
- Assist in returns and damages process.
- Perform record reviews to ensure compliance with all applicable procedures and regulations.
- Take part on ISM (Inventory System Management) after hours rotation program.
- Assist in validation projects.
- Being able to be on call for WebCTRL temperature monitoring on a rotation program.
- Assist in generating and reviewing temperature monthly reports in a timely manner.
- Other duties as assigned.
